Function - the job that something has or does System - a group of parts that work together to do a job
FUNCTIONS OF THE SKELETAL SYSTEM: * Protection * Support * Movement

sternum = breast bone
Spinal column = backbone Spinal column is composed of vertebrae https://humananatomyskeletoninindia.wordpress.com/
Radius and ulna = lower arm bones
pelvis = hip area
femur = upper leg/ thigh bone
patella = kneecap
phalanges = finger bones and toe bones
Clavicle = collarbone
Tibia and fibula = lower leg bones
